WebEntering a highway from an on ramp can be a stressful situation, especially for new drivers. Most states give the right of way to the vehicle that is traveling on the highway. The vehicle entering must yield to those vehicles, but there are a few states that indicate both drivers must attempt to adjust their speed and location to avoid a collision. WebAn over-the-road truck driver may drive around 600 miles in a full day on the highway, but a more realistic expectation is probably closer to 400 to 500 miles per shift. Weekly, a lot of fleet owners plan for about 2,000 miles per week for every truck. Planning for a few weeks of downtime, that gets somewhere close to 100,000 miles per year.
